引言:
TP钱包(TokenPocket 等移动/多链钱包的代表性产品)处于区块链用户入口的位置,其设计和运营直接影响链上体验与生态发展。本文从高可用性、合约标准、市场未来、交易记录、可扩展性与安全策略六个维度,系统阐述行业前沿要点与实践建议。
一、高可用性(High Availability)
高可用性依赖于多层冗余与快速故障恢复。关键做法包括:多地域分布式后端节点(RPC 节点、索引节点、签名服务)与负载均衡、服务熔断与降级策略、无状态服务设计与持久化外包(数据库与消息队列集群)、自动化监控与告警(Prometheus/Grafana/Alertmanager)、定期演练(故障恢复演练、RTO/RPO 测试)。对于钱包类产品,确保签名服务与私钥管理的高可用同时不降低安全性极为关键,通常采用主动/被动多副本与隔离备份策略。
二、合约标准(Contract / Token Standards)
钱包需要支持多链与多种代币标准:以太坊系的ERC-20/ERC-721/ERC-1155、BSC的BEP-20、TRON的TRC20、Solana、NEAR 等各自标准。同时要实现通用的ABI解析、合约校验、合约交互模板(approve/transfer/swap/stake等),并兼容EIP(如EIP-1559的费率模型、EIP-712的结构化签名)以提升用户体验与安全。建议保持标准库更新、对非标准合约做白名单与风险标注,并提供合约源码验证与审计摘要展示功能。

三、市场未来发展(Market Outlook)
钱包将从“资产管理工具”进一步演化为“区块链入口操作系统”:聚合跨链通道、内置DApp 商店与社交功能、原生DeFi/NFT生态、与L2/侧链的深度整合,以及对央行数字货币(CBDC)与合规托管服务的适配。短中期看,多链资产聚合与跨链桥安全性将是竞争焦点;长期则是用户体验(低手续费、快速确认)、合规与机构化服务(托管、合规KYC/AML)的平衡。
四、交易记录(Transaction History 与链上数据)
交易记录展示需兼顾实时性、准确性与隐私。实践要点包括:使用索引服务(自建或第三方,如The Graph)做链上数据解析、缓存与去重;本地加密存储用户历史以支持离线访问与数据导出(CSV/JSON);提供可验证的链上哈希链接以便审计;设计隐私保护选项(仅本地存储、不上传用户敏感元数据)。在展示方面,应提供费用明细、代币价格换算、合约调用原文与可读化说明以提升透明度。
五、可扩展性(Scalability)
钱包服务的可扩展性体现在两端:前端(用户并发、UI 渲染)与后端(RPC 调用、索引、签名队列)。解决方案包括:RPC 池化与智能路由(按链负载选择健康节点)、请求合并与缓存(减轻热点请求)、批量签名与交易打包、采用 L2 或 Rollup 做费率优化与吞吐提升、微服务拆分与自动扩缩容、以及边缘计算与CDN缓存静态资源。对链上事件的处理可利用事件流(Kafka)与分布式处理实现高吞吐的索引更新。
六、安全策略(Security)
安全为钱包首要属性,需覆盖密钥管理、运行时安全、合约与依赖安全、以及运营层面:
- 密钥管理:优先支持助记词加密、本地加密存储、硬件钱包与安全执行环境(TEE)、多方计算(MPC)或多重签名(Multisig)方案;助记词导出/导入需标准化并防止明文泄露。
- 运行时:代码审计、第三方库依赖扫描、持续渗透测试、沙箱化DApp、行为分析与异常交易拦截(风控引擎)。
- 合约与生态安全:推荐与展示合约审计报告、对高风险合约进行警示、限制自动授权的批量额度并支持撤销授权(revoke)。

- 运维与应急:制定事故响应流程、保留不可变审计日志、部署冷备份与法务合规通道、运行赏金计划与漏洞披露机制。
结论与建议:
TP类钱包的竞争力来自于对用户信任与体验的双重保障。短期应聚焦高可用、合约标准兼容与强化安全防护;中长期需布局跨链可扩展性、L2整合与合规托管服务。实践中,做到“透明(可审计)、安全(多层防护)、高可用(多地域容灾)”三者并重,方能在不断演变的市场中保持领先。
评论
Alice
很实用的一篇概览,尤其是对高可用性的实践细节讲得清楚。
链圈小李
关于合约标准那节推荐给开发团队,尤其是EIP-712和签名处理部分。
CryptoBear
赞同把MPC和硬件钱包并举,企业级用户会更看重这些方案。
张晓萌
交易记录那部分写得细,索引和隐私平衡是个硬问题。
Dev_Network
建议补充一些具体的监控指标(如RPC延迟、签名队列长度)对运维帮助大。